The Role of Predictive Analytics

Predictive analytics takes these statistical insights a step further, utilizing historical data and algorithms to forecast future outcomes. These predictions aren’t about guaranteeing results – sports are inherently unpredictable – but rather about identifying probabilities and informing smarter decision-making. Understanding the factors that contribute to a team’s likelihood of success, or a player’s potential for a strong performance, can dramatically enhance the fan experience. Furthermore, sophisticated models can account for variables like injuries, weather conditions, and even opponent matchups, providing a more holistic and realistic assessment of potential outcomes. This level of analysis would have been unimaginable even a decade ago.

Statistic
Description
Win Probability Added (WPA) Measures a player's impact on a team's chance of winning.
Value Over Replacement Player (VORP) Estimates how much more a player contributes than a readily available replacement.
Expected Goals (xG) Calculates the likelihood that a shot will result in a goal.
Adjusted Plus-Minus A more refined measure of a player's offensive and defensive contributions.

Responsible Gaming Considerations

However, it's crucial to address the potential risks associated with sports betting, particularly the issue of responsible gaming. Platforms have a responsibility to provide tools and resources to help users manage their betting activity and avoid problem gambling. This includes features like deposit limits, self-exclusion options, and links to support organizations. Promoting responsible gaming is not only ethically sound but also essential for the long-term sustainability of the industry. Transparency and player protection should be paramount.
